Bhansali always bring Indian culture in front of the world, we need to appreciates his efforts: Pahlaj Nihalan

The former chief of Central Board of Film Certification (CBFC) Mr.Pahlaj Nihalan on Friday entitle famous director in the Bollywood, Sanjay Leela Bhansali as "a sensible" person who has always promoted Indian culture in his films. The Director of the movie Sanjay Leela Bhansali whose ongoing controversy surrounding 'Padmavati', Nihalani said that, "Bhansali is a sensible and best technician in the industry. He knows that he is bringing Indian culture in front of the world. He has always promoted Indian culture and people have liked it".

The film director pointed out that every Bhansali productions film falls in controversy even though there is nothing objectionable in it. “There has been controversy in each of his films. Controversy on his projects is created by people. His movies have always done a good business after people see there is nothing wrong with it".

"People of every state for which he makes a film protest against it. People protested against Bajirao Mastani in Maharashtra. There were many court cases. I think how he highlighted Maratha in that film was commendable”.

Nihalani also highlighted that there was a film made on Padmavati in 1963 but there were no protests. Nihalani, who was popular for making several cuts in movies as the CBFC chief, said that approving the film is the responsibility of the censor board, not public or government.

"Till the time film is not censored, it is not completed. I think they have not yet submitted it for approval, the process which takes at least 21 days.
